What is the cheapest month to fly from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ada is November, when tickets cost C$ 650 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are January and April,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is C$ 1,136 and C$ 1,084 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below-average price on a flight from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port to Canada, you should book around 3 weeks before departure, which saves you about 28%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 19 weeks before departure.

FAQs - booking Canada flights

  • Where can I fly to in Canada from Kuala Lumpur?

    There are flights to various destinations in Canada that depart from Kuala Lumpur Airport, but some of the most popular destinations are Toronto, Montreal and Vancouver. All of these destinations require at least one stop on the way, and the flight to Toronto takes around 22h and stops over in Hong Kong. The flight to Montreal stops in Doha and is provided by Malaysia Airlines, which is the main airline for Kuala Lumpur Airport. To fly to Vancouver, you can fly with Turkish Airlines and stopover in Istanbul, on a flight that takes about 31h.

  • What are my options for travelling to the city centre from the different Canadian airports?

    To get to the city centre from Toronto Lester B. Pearson International Airport (YYZ), you can take a roughly 25min train ride or a 1h bus journey (where you will need to change between the number 34 and 320 buses). A taxi will take around 23min. You can get a bus to the city centre of Montreal from the airport in about 20min, and a taxi takes a similar amount of time but is more expensive. Vancouver International Airport (YVR) offers an approximately 17min bus ride or a 24min subway to get to the city centre.

Top tips for finding cheap flights to Canada

  • Kuala Lumpur International Airport (KUL) has two main terminals for the public. KLIA Main is the first terminal, and the second is called KLIA2. They are 2 km apart, so take care when travelling to the airport that you go to the correct terminal.
  • There are currently no direct flights from Kuala Lumpur to Canada, but there are several airlines that offer one-stop flights to Toronto, Montreal and Vancouver, to name a few destinations. Malaysia Airlines, Cathay Pacific, Etihad and Turkish Airlines are some examples.
  • There are family-care rooms situated throughout the airport in Kuala Lumpur, where you can feed and change your child in peace and comfort. There are also a number of baby strollers available in various locations in the two terminals. KUL Kidzania is a children’s playground that you can find in the main terminal.
  • Kuala Lumpur Airport is fitted with ramps and easy access restrooms for passengers with reduced mobility or disabilities. The airport also has a calm room and sensory walls for passengers who may feel stressed in the busy environment.
